Ultrasound technicians make use of sonographic machines to help the doctors in making the right diagnosis for the patient’s condition.
These ultrasound technicians are in charge of the whole sonographic procedure to create images of the organs, tissues, and blood flow inside in the patient’s body with the use if transducers and high frequency sound waves. The doctors make use of this images produced by the sonographic machines in making a correct diagnosis of the patient’s medical condition. X-ray and ultrasound may be similar in nature, but instead of radiation, ultrasound makes use of sound waves instead. Proper training and education is required for those who are interested in going for an ultrasound technician career. If you want to get the best training for this career, it is a must that you take a program from one of the accredited schools in the country. You can choose from among the different levels of education which are an Associate’s, Bachelor’s, or a Master’s degree program. Completing the program in sonography then allows you to work as an ultrasound technician, but it is recommended that the technician is first registered with the ARDMS or the American Radiological and Diagnostic Medical Sonographer. Even if registration is not mandatory to all states, it can improve your chances of great job prospects and getting a good ultrasound technician salary.
The specific amount of the ultrasound technician salary depends on the state, education, and experience of the technician. Typically, private doctors provide a higher salary for ultrasound technicians as compared to general hospitals. The mean annual salary of technicians is $63,640 for the year 2009, as stated by the Bureau of Labor Statistics. By just looking at the average income of an ultrasound technician, we can say that it is indeed on a competitive level. The highest ten percent of the employed ultrasound technicians can even earn more than $85,000 every year.
The growing need for ultrasound technicians is considered as one of the fastest among other professions and it may be due to the increasing availability of these specialized sonographic equipments in almost any medical facility. The United States Bureau of Labor Statistics presented that there is a 19% growth in the employment opportunities for ultrasound technicians from 2008 to 2018.
